YURII Posted November 17, 2017 Posted November 17, 2017 Hello, I try to work with text in Photo, but all the font, no matter how large, seem to have some sort of antialiasing issue, is there a way to fix it? Quote
Staff MEB Posted November 17, 2017 Staff Posted November 17, 2017 Hi YURII, Welcome to Affinity Forums Go to Affinity Photo Preferences, Performance section and check if you have the View Quality dropdown set to Bilinear (Best Quality). I believe your screenshot was taken at an arbitrary zoom level which doesn't help. If you view it at 100%, 200% or 400% it should display correctly without these "artefacts" (still pixelated depending on the zoom level but that's expected).
